Does relational leadership generate organizational social capital? A case of exploring the effect of relational leadership on organizational social capital in China
oleh: Tayyaba Akram, Shen Lei, Syed Talib Hussain, Muhammad Jamal Haider, Muhammad Waqar Akram

The aim of this study was to investigate the effect of relational leadership on organizational social capital. Three forms of organizational social capital namely structural, relational and cognitive organizational social capital are used as dependent variables. Using self- administered questionnaire, Data of 240 employees was collected from an IT company in China. Data was analyzed using correlation and multiple regression analysis. Results of this study suggested that relational leadership plays a positive and significant role in generating structural and relational organizational social capital. However, this study failed in finding the effect of relational leadership on cognitive organizational social capital. Practical implications and limitations are also provided at the end.
